1946143611Los Angeles: Beacon Productions 1946. Final Draft script for the 1947 film. Copy likely belonging to an uncredited costume designer with annotations in holograph pencil throughout. <br/><br/>Groucho Marx's first solo film appearance and his first with a real mustache as opposed to one made with grease paint. Marx plays an incompetent theatrical agent whose only client is Carmen Miranda in her first film after leaving Twentieth Century-Fox and who he tries to pass off as two different performers. <br/> <br/>Set in New York City and shot there on location. <br/><br/>Tan titled wrappers noted as Final Draft on the front wrapper dated October 28 1946. Title page integral with the first page of the text. 97 leaves with last page of text numbered 97. Mimeograph on pink stock. Pages Near Fine wrapper Good bound with two silver brads. 1970139973Los Angeles: Twentieth Century-Fox 1970. US one sheet poster for the 1970s re-release of 1943 film. Nominated for an Academy Award. <br/><br/>Considered by many to be Busby Berkeley's masterpiece though there are several high spots to choose from "The Gang's All Here" is indisputably the master film choreographer's wildest and most ambitious effort with staging and camerawork that are still somewhat unexplainable today and shot in blazing Technicolor to boot. The film also boasts Carmen Miranda's finest hour the sparkling "Girl in the Tutti-Frutti Hat." <br/><br/>Shot on location in Los Angeles California. <br/><br/>27 x 41 inches folded. Very Good plus with a red holograph ink notation to the verso pin holes and light wear along the folds. <br/><br/>Hirschhorn p. 232. Twentieth Century-Fox unknown books

193727068New York: John C. Yorston Publishing Co 1937. First Edition. Octavo 20.5cm; green cloth with titling and decorations stamped in gilt to spine and front cover; dustjacket; 321pp; illus. Beginning oxidation to spine gilt with a touch of discoloration to surrounding spine cloth; Near Fine. Dustjacket is unclipped priced $2.00 with light edgewear and gentle sunning to spine; Near Fine. Novelized version of the real-life events surrounding the birth of Georgia Norwood the first child born at the Boston Lighthouse in Boston Harbor. During a spring storm in 1932 Georgia's mother Josephine Norwood believed the birth was imminent and a doctor was summond from a nearby town. It took an hour and a half for the boat to land at the island in heavy seas and though Georgia wasn't born until a week later in calm weather. she would be forever known as "Storm Child. John C.
